Distance From Grati Airport to Kenneth Kaunda International Airport

The distance from Grati Airport () to Kenneth Kaunda International Airport (LUN) is 5720 miles or 9206 kilometers or 4968 nautical miles.

Why should you arrive 3 hours before international flight? Flyers who are traveling to an international destination should arrive at the airport earlier than domestic flyers. This is because international flights can have additional check-in requirements, like passport verification, that need to be completed before you receive your boarding pass.
